What makes the glass type and design in classic glass espresso cups so important, and how do thickness, heat resistance, and clarity affect your espresso experience?

The glass type and wall construction determine heat retention, crema preservation, and durability. Borosilicate glass resists thermal shock, while double‑wall designs insulate and keep the exterior cool to the touch; thinner rims feel more delicate and improve mouthfeel, whereas thicker walls add heft and warmth. In practice, choose a brand with consistent quality and decide between a clear, classic single‑wall look or an insulated option to suit your serving style.

What maintenance and compatibility tips should you know for classic glass espresso cups to keep them safe and sturdy?

Always inspect for chips or cracks before use and avoid rapid temperature changes to prevent cracks. Check whether the cups are dishwasher‑safe and follow manufacturer guidance on cleaning; use gentle detergents and avoid abrasive scrubbing. Make sure the cup diameter fits under your espresso machine’s group head and into your cup warmer to ensure a seamless service flow.
